Information Apply for Passports in Andhra Pradesh

Before the application in Andhra Pradesh, you can check the following information:

1. First, all the necessary documents and annexures are checked before starting the application process.
2. Then, go to the government portal to fill up your application.
3. Next, you check your documents as per the application form.
4. After submitting your application online, you must pay fees as per the type or pages.
5. After that, you book an appointment at Seva Kendra (PSK) or Post Office Seva Kendra (POPSK) as per your location. 
6. Thereafter, carry all original documents with self-attested photocopies.
7. Finally, after completing your process, you must check your status.

 

Check Passport Status in Andhra Pradesh

After the application, you can check status in Andhra Pradesh by following step

Step 1 First, you go to the government website
Step 2 Then, click "Track Application Status" on the home page
Step 3 Next, select application type.
Step 4 After that, fill up file number and date of birth
Step 5 Finally, click "Track Status," and you can show your status.
Reminder: You get the file number in your received copy, and you get status by sending an SMS to 9704100100 in the format '<< STATUS>><< SPACE>><< File Number>>

 

Passport Getting Time in Andhra Pradesh 

You can find information on getting time in Andhra Pradesh.

Normal  30 to 45 days
Renew 20 to 30 days
Tatkaal 7 days to 10 Days
Minor  15 to 25 days
Lost or Damaged 35 to 45 days
PCC Certificate 15 days
Police Verification  within 21 days

Districts Covered in Office: Andhra Pradesh

Andhra Pradesh office covers the districts of Krishna, Sri Potti Sriramulu Nellore, Tirupati, Guntur, Palnadu, Prakasam, Bapatla, NTR District, Annamayya, Chittoor, YSR District, Sri Sathya Sai, Kurnool, Nandyal, and Ananthapuramu.

11/04/2025

Server Crash

A massive server failure in India’s passports system disrupted services for the second consecutive day on Wednesday, leaving applicants across major cities in chaos. What began as a technical snag on Tuesday escalated into a full-blown nationwide outage, with canceled appointments, long queues, and inadequate communication from authorities.

 

10/04/2025

Update for Marriage Certificate

The ministry has also made it clear that in order to remove a spouse’s name from a passport, a divorce decree or order is still mandatory. A source stated that to change the name of a spouse on the passport, applicants must provide a divorce decree, death certificate of the first spouse, a remarriage certificate, or a Joint Photo Declaration (Annexure J) signed by both parties.
